Voices The Tech Take: The genderless face of accounting bots
(Accounting Today) - Last year, Sage debuted Pegg, a simple accounting bot that integrates with Facebook Messenger and Slack. The bot’s icon looks like the Nerd emoji with a round yellow head and big, owlish glasses. No nose, no mouth — and no gender.

Metric of the Month: Days Payable Outstanding
(CFO) - Companies that put payment terms pressure on their suppliers often don’t realize the economic ripple effects of their actions. Not that long ago, negotiating extended payment terms was equivalent to tossing out a red flag to signal that the company was in trouble.
